Ingredients
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on active dry yeast
- 3/4 cup warm water
- 1 teaspoon sugar
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 cup tomato sauce
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1 teaspoon dried basil
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ese
- 30–40 slices large pepperoni

Instructions
- Instructions:
- In a mixing bowl, combine warm water, sugar, and yeast. Let sit for 5–10 minutes until foamy.
- Add flour, salt, and olive oil to the yeast mixture. Mix until a dough forms.
- Knead the dough on a lightly floured surface for 8–10 minutes until smooth and elastic.
- Place dough in an oiled bowl, cover, and let rise for 1 hour or until doubled in size.
- Preheat oven to 475°F (245°C) with a pizza stone or baking sheet inside.
- Punch down dough and roll out on a floured surface into a large circle about 1/4" thick.
- Transfer rolled dough onto a pizza peel dusted with flour or cornmeal.
- In a small bowl, combine tomato sauce, oregano, basil, and garlic powder.
- Spread sauce evenly over the dough using a ladle.
- Sprinkle shredded mozzarella cheese over the sauce.
- Arrange large pepperoni slices generously over the cheese.
- Slide pizza onto the preheated pizza stone or baking sheet using the peel.
- Bake for 12–15 minutes until crust is golden and cheese is bubbly and slightly browned.
- Remove pizza from oven and transfer to a cutting board.
- Slice with a pizza cutter and serve hot.

Tips
Make sure your yeast mixture is properly activated and foamy before mixing in the flour to ensure the dough rises well. Use a pizza peel dusted with flour or cornmeal to prevent sticking when transferring the rolled dough to the oven. Preheating the pizza stone or baking sheet to 475degF is crucial for achieving a crispy, golden-brown crust. Let your pizza cool slightly before slicing with a pizza cutter to maintain clean cuts and avoid cheese slipping.

Storage
To store your XLNY Giant Pepperoni Pizza from Papa Murphy's, wrap any leftover slices tightly in aluminum foil or plastic wrap and place them in an airtight container to retain moisture and flavor. Refrigerate within two hours of baking to prevent bacterial growth and consume within 3-4 days for best taste and safety. For longer storage, freeze the wrapped pizza slices, and reheat in a preheated oven at 375degF until thoroughly warmed to preserve the crispness of the crust.
